Overview

Digoxin + empagliflozin is a combination of two pharmaceutical agents used primarily in the management of cardiovascular and metabolic diseases. Digoxin is a cardiac glycoside that increases the force of myocardial contraction (positive inotropy) and decreases heart rate (negative chronotropy) by inhibiting the sodium-potassium ATPase enzyme, leading to increased intracellular calcium in cardiac cells. It is mainly indicated for heart failure and certain arrhythmias such as atrial fibrillation[6]. Empagliflozin is a selective sodium-glucose co-transporter 2 (SGLT2) inhibitor that lowers blood glucose by promoting urinary glucose excretion. It also reduces cardiovascular risk, slows progression of chronic kidney disease, and reduces hospitalization for heart failure in patients with type 2 diabetes or established cardiovascular/renal disease[2][3][5]. The combination may be considered when both glycemic control and cardiac support are needed.
